Hvordan Utgang Escape tegn til fil i PHP

Når du skriver til en fil med PHP, må du noen ganger utgangsspesialtegn til filen. For eksempel, hvis du ønsker å sette inn en ny linje i en datafil, må du sende ut et vognreturtegn og en linjeskift-tegnet til filen. Fordi disse er ikke utskrivbare tegn, må du bruke spesielle escape-tegn for å representere dem i filen. En flukt karakter er en kombinasjon av de frem-slash karakter og et tegn forkortelse.

Bruksanvisning

1 Opprett en ny PHP program fil ved hjelp av en redaktør. For eksempel inn:

nano escapeout.php

2 Åpne en fil i skrivemodus. For eksempel inn:

<? Php

$ Fh = fopen ( "output.dat", "w");

if (! $ fh) die ( "Kunne ikke åpne output file!");

3 Lag en variabel til å lagre dataene du ønsker å skrive til filen. Tilsett vognreturskiftetegnet "\ r" og escape-tegnet ny-line "\ n" til variabelen. For eksempel inn:

$ Output = "Dette er det utgang strengen for filen \ r \ n";

4 Skriv dataene i filen og lukke filen. For eksempel inn:

fputs ($ fh, $ utgang);

fclose ($ fh);

?>

5 Avslutt redaktør og lagre filen. Naviger til filen i en nettleser for å kjøre den og teste programmets funksjonalitet.